First-of-Its-Kind: Governor's Iftar Initiative Strengthens Bonds Among Kwara Residents

Date: 2025-03-19

In the spirit of Ramadan and Lent, Kwara State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q, CON, hosted members of the Kwara Comrades Community, youth leaders, and key stakeholders for an iftar/breaking of fast event at the newly revitalised Flower Garden in Ilorin on Wednesday, March 18, 2025. Represented by his Senior Special Assistant on New Media, Olayinka Fafoluyi (popularly known as Solace), the governor emphasised the importance of unity and fostering love among residents during the gathering.

Solace highlighted that Governor AbdulRazaq has cultivated a new generation of young leaders in Kwara, while former Commissioner Ibrahim Akaje chaired the event. Additionally, the governor's representative distributed 200 bags of 10kg rice to attendees, symbolising support for vulnerable groups during the holy periods.

Basambo, the former Labour Party (LP) governorship candidate in Kwara, described the event as a first-of-its-kind initiative within the state, aimed at promoting inclusivity and cohesion. The governor's office announced plans to hold similar gatherings three times a year moving forward, reinforcing efforts to strengthen communal bonds and harmony.

This event follows a similar one held just five days prior, where the governor entertained the state's new media team, including Kwara online publishers and social media influencers, further showcasing his administration's commitment to engaging diverse groups across the state.

The event, held at the Flower Garden Ilorin, brought together comrades, government officials, and other dignitaries to dine and drink to celebrate the Holy Month.

Chaired by Hon. Ibrahim Akaje, the event reunited the Senior Comrades, particularly those who had not seen one another for years due to one or two reasons. The Comrades, excited to reunite again, had progressive brotherly discussions and shared their experiences as student politicians and stakeholders in several youth constituencies across the state.

The former Commissioner for Housing and Urban Development appreciated the Comrades for honouring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q through Solace's invitation to the event. He commended the Senior Special Assistant for bringing together former student leaders and young stakeholders across the state. He added that the event would foster peace and enhance the relationship among the youths in the state.

Similarly, the former LP Governorship Candidate, Comrade Bassambo, lauded Hon. Olayinka Fafoluyi for hosting the leaders of all youth constituencies across the state for the breaking of fast.

Bassambo described the event as the first of its kind in the state and commended the Comrades for making it lively by sharing their on- and off-campus experiences.

For his part, Hon. Solace said he was elated by the turnout and expressed his heartfelt appreciation to Governor AbdulRazaq, who has made new sets of young, generational leaders. He also thanked all the Comrades who graced the occasion. Preaching for peace among them, he noted that the program will now be held thrice a year to foster peace, love, and unity among youth constituencies in the state.
